
La Virgen de San Juan de los Remedios
La Virgen de San Juan de los Remedios is a revered figure in Catholicism, specifically as the patron saint of the city of San Juan de los Remedios in Cuba. She is often depicted as a compassionate figure, believed to provide protection and help to the faithful. Her feast day is celebrated on December 8, attracting many pilgrims. The Virgin symbolizes hope, healing, and community strength, reflecting the deep cultural and spiritual heritage of the Cuban people. Her image is central to local traditions and festivities, emphasizing a blend of religious devotion and regional identity.
